State about the Three-dimensional digitizers
Three-dimensional digitizers use sonic or electromagnetic transmissions to record positions. One electromagnet transmission method is similar to that used in the data glove. A coupling between the transmitter and receiver is used to compute the location of a stylus as it moves over the surface of an object. As the points are selected on a non-metallic object, a wireframe outline of the surface is displayed on the compute screen. Once the surface outline is constructed, it can be shaded with lighting effects to produce a realistic display of the object. Resolution of this system is from 0.8 mm to 0.08 mm, depending on the model.
